What is the Difference Between C: and D:?

The C: and D: drives on a computer represent different storage locations. The C: drive is typically the primary storage location where the operating system is installed, while the D: drive is often used for additional storage or as a recovery partition. Understanding the roles of these drives can help in managing files and optimizing computer performance.

What is the C: Drive Used For?

The C: drive is the default location for the operating system and system files. It is critical for the computer’s functionality and often contains:

  • The Windows operating system (for Windows PCs)
  • Installed software and applications
  • System files and settings
  • User profile data, including documents and desktop files

Why is the C: Drive Important?

The C: drive is essential because it houses the operating system, which is necessary for running the computer. It also contains vital system files that ensure the computer operates smoothly. Regular maintenance, such as disk cleanup and defragmentation, can help keep the C: drive running efficiently.

What is the D: Drive Used For?

The D: drive can serve various purposes depending on the computer’s configuration:

  • Secondary Storage: Used for storing additional files such as music, videos, and documents.
  • Recovery Partition: Some manufacturers use the D: drive as a recovery partition, containing backup files for system restoration.
  • Optical Drive: On some older systems, the D: drive refers to the CD/DVD drive.

How to Use the D: Drive Effectively?

Utilizing the D: drive for non-essential files can help free up space on the C: drive, improving system performance. For systems where the D: drive is a recovery partition, it is best left untouched to ensure you have a backup in case of system failure.

How to Manage Storage on C: and D: Drives?

Efficient storage management can prevent slowdown and optimize performance:

  • Regular Cleanup: Use disk cleanup tools to remove unnecessary files from the C: drive.
  • Transfer Files: Move large media files to the D: drive to free up space.
  • Backup Data: Regularly back up important files to an external drive or cloud storage.

What Happens if the C: Drive is Full?

When the C: drive is full, it can slow down your computer and cause system errors. It’s important to regularly delete unnecessary files and programs to maintain optimal performance.

Can I Install Programs on the D: Drive?

Yes, you can install programs on the D: drive to save space on the C: drive. However, some programs may still require components to be installed on the C: drive.

How Do I Access the D: Drive?

To access the D: drive, open the File Explorer and look for the D: drive under "This PC." You can then manage files and folders stored there.

Is the D: Drive Always Present?

Not all computers have a D: drive. Its presence depends on the system configuration and whether additional storage or recovery partitions are set up.

Can I Change the Drive Letters?

Yes, you can change drive letters using the Disk Management tool in Windows. However, changing the C: drive letter is not recommended as it can lead to system errors.
